Trapezoidal Sheet
T
rapezoidal sheets are a robust and aesthetic building material widely used in the construction and industrial sectors. Typically made from galvanized steel or aluminum, they are shaped into a trapezoidal form using special molds. This design enhances the sheet's strength, making structures more durable. Trapezoidal sheets are frequently chosen for roofing and facade cladding due to their durability and aesthetic appeal. The protective coatings applied to the sheets improve their resistance to corrosion, ensuring their longevity.
Trapezoidal sheets are commonly used in roofing and facade cladding, warehouses, industrial buildings, garages, canopies, and agricultural structures. Their lightweight structure makes them easy to apply without adding extra load to the roofing system. The different thicknesses and profile options of trapezoidal sheets allow architects and engineers to combine aesthetics and functionality in their projects. The trapezoidal shape on the sheet's surface allows water and snow to flow off the roof more easily, enhancing the structure's waterproofing.
Trapezoidal sheets can be produced in various sizes and thicknesses. The production processes are typically carried out in accordance with national and international standards such as TS EN 10346. These standards guarantee the mechanical properties and corrosion resistance of trapezoidal sheets. Galvanized trapezoidal sheets are protected with a zinc coating, providing resistance to corrosion in outdoor applications. Colored trapezoidal sheets are preferred in projects with aesthetic concerns to match the overall design of the building.
One of the biggest advantages of trapezoidal sheets is their ease of installation and lightweight structure. They can be easily cut and screwed in both construction sites and workshops, enabling projects to be completed quickly. Their modular structure allows for fast assembly even in large areas, and the screws and sealing systems used during installation create a secure structure in terms of watertightness. Additionally, the paints and protective coatings applied to the trapezoidal sheets help maintain the aesthetic appearance of the sheet while providing extra protection against corrosion and UV rays.
Trapezoidal sheets not only enhance the durability of structures but also provide an economical solution. In projects where large areas need to be covered, they stand out as a cost-effective building material. When used in industrial buildings, such as warehouses and hangars, their robust structure ensures years of reliable performance. Additionally, trapezoidal sheets can be produced with insulation to improve soundproofing, which enhances both sound and thermal insulation, contributing to energy efficiency.
